THREE men accused of carrying out a burglary spree across Devon have declined to give evidence at their trial.
The Lithuanian men from London are alleged to have raided 23 homes in Devon and 16 in Sussex, Lincolnshire and Suffolk in the space of eight months.
All the raids were on homes with UPV doors or French windows which have a particular type of cylinder lock which can be broken open to allow access by a technique known as snapping.
The jury at Exeter Crown Court was told that all three decided not to give evidence in their own defence and barristers representing them have dismissed the prosecution case as speculation.
Arturas Malysovas, aged 31, of South Esk Road, London; Dainius Gastilavicius, aged 39, of Worcester Road, East London, and Tomas Paulavicius, aged 36, of Raydons Road, Dagenham, all deny conspiracy to burgle.
The prosecution say evidence from their satnav, phones cell site analysis and number plate recognition cameras shows they travelled to Devon on the dates when they raids were carried out.
Two of the men allegedly left DNA traces at a house in Peard Road, Tiverton, while the third’s DNA was found on a glove mark at a house in Paignton.
The gang allegedly struck in towns including Exeter, Exmouth, Tiverton, Newton Abbot, Dartmouth, Ashburton and Paignton and in villages such as Chillington and Stokenham in the South Hams.
Defence barristers William Parkhill, Brian Fitzherbert and Barry White all told the jury at Exeter Crown Court that their clients had exercised their right not to give evidence.
They told the jury the prosecution case was based on inference rather than hard fact and the DNA evidence could be explained by other people using gloves which the men had worn previously.
They argued that others could have used the satnav, phones or cars and described the prosecution case as supposition, assumption and speculation.
